Latest news: Poland unveiled a €144 billion program to build 4,700 km of new railways and modernize 5,600 km, a major infrastructure boost. In technology, Stadler launched the first narrow-gauge hydrogen train for Sardinia, Italy, to decarbonize regional services, while PKP Intercity began testing its Newag Impuls3 DEMU in Poland. Separately, an Alstom-led consortium secured €690m to modernize Egypt's rail corridors, and Italian FS signed an MoU with Saudi Railway Company for MENA rail projects.
